INTERNAL MEMO — Sales Leads Only

Re: Divestiture of the Cormant Analytics unit

The sale of Cormant Analytics to Bellweather Holdings closes end of quarter. Effective immediately: no new multi-year contracts touching Cormant products. Existing pipeline deals proceed; flag anything above standard terms to your regional head. Customer messaging is being drafted centrally — do not improvise. Staff transfers are handled separately by HR. Questions go through your lead, not directly to the deal team. Context for this decision follows.

board note of bawep-tajef: Queniusek Systems plans to raise the Quenvan list price by 53.1 percent in March. The pricing group signed off on a budget of $176.4 million for Project Drueth. The renewal with Casionix Partners closes at $142.5 million a year, 8.3 percent below the last contract. Project Fraax slips by six weeks because of the tooling delay.

## Break-Glass: Driftline SDK Parity Builds

When the Kotlin and Swift Driftline SDKs drift out of parity before a release cut, the parity gate blocks publishing. If the gate misfires and the fix is verified, the release manager may override via the break-glass account. Log the override in the release channel. The account's recovery passphrase follows below.

unlock words, tawif-tahop: oliys-ulawyn-tamdor-lamys-casox-jormir-fraius-kasath-ulador-ulamir-holir-sorys-holeth

Handover note — Crumbwheel order cutoffs.

Welcome aboard. The bakery cutoff rule in Crumbwheel closes same-day orders at 14:00 local to each storefront, not UTC — this has bitten us twice. Holiday overrides live in the calendar service and take precedence silently, so always check there first when a cutoff looks wrong. To unlock the calendar service's admin console after a restart, enter the recovery passphrase below.

vault phrase of bagap-bahaf = silion-pelox-sorox-casdor-quenwyn-fraax-eliox-praael-kelion-quenvan-kasox-rusael-norius-belvan